  • The ongoing conflict between Russia and Ukraine, which began in February 2022, has seen a significant escalation with recent threats from Russia. The absence of a peace deal continues to prolong the war, impacting both nations and the broader region.
  • As tensions rise, the international community is closely monitoring the situation, fearing further destabilization.
  • Since the onset of the war, various attempts at negotiation have failed, leaving both Russia and Ukraine entrenched in their respective positions. The conflict has not only affected the two nations but has also had significant repercussions on global security, energy supplies, and international relations.
  • Russia's latest threats towards Ukraine signal a troubling shift in the dynamics of the conflict, indicating that diplomatic avenues may be closing. This escalation could lead to increased military engagement, drawing in more international actors and complicating the already fragile geopolitical landscape.
